The Madurai bench of the Madras High Court expressed strong criticism of Tamilaga Vettri Kazhagam (TVK) leaders following a chaotic public event, noting that party chief Vijay fled from the scene of occurrence. Justice Senthilkumar reserved orders on anticipatory bail petitions filed by TVK leaders Bussy Anand and CTR Nirmal Kumar.
He asked pointed questions about the organisers’ responsibility and the police’s preparedness. The court is also considering a separate public interest litigation (PIL) seeking to restrain the Home Secretary and the Director General of Police from granting permission for road shows until proper guidelines or standard operating procedures (SOPs) are formulated.
